源代码2 项目: gef   文件: BindingUtils.java
/**
 * Creates a unidirectional content binding from the given source
 * {@link Multiset} to the given target {@link ObservableMultiset}.
 *
 * @param <E>
 *            The element type of the given {@link Multiset} and
 *            {@link ObservableMultiset}.
 * @param source
 *            The {@link Multiset} whose content to update when the given
 *            {@link ObservableMultiset} changes.
 * @param target
 *            The {@link ObservableMultiset} whose content is to be
 *            observed.
 */
public static <E> void bindContent(Multiset<E> source,
		ObservableMultiset<? extends E> target) {
	if (source == null) {
		throw new NullPointerException("Cannot bind null value.");
	}
	if (target == null) {
		throw new NullPointerException("Cannot bind to null value.");
	}
	if (source == target) {
		throw new IllegalArgumentException("Cannot bind source to itself.");
	}

	if (source instanceof ObservableMultiset) {
		// ensure we use an atomic operation in case the source multiset is
		// observable.
		((ObservableMultiset<E>) source).replaceAll(target);
	} else {
		source.clear();
		source.addAll(target);
	}

	final UnidirectionalMultisetContentBinding<E> contentBinding = new UnidirectionalMultisetContentBinding<>(
			source);
	// clear any previous bindings
	target.removeListener(contentBinding);
	// add new binding as listener
	target.addListener(contentBinding);
}
